Princess Kate Middleton won’t carry out her role as Inspecting Officer this year, the palace confirmed on Thursday, May 30. Her role will be carried out by Lieutenant General James Bucknall, KCB, CBE. There’s no official word yet on whether Kate, 42, will attend the actual event, which will be held on June 15 and celebrates the official birthday of the British Sovereign.
“This is a clear commitment she has made throughout her life of public service that this will be focus. That will continue when she returns to work,” a Kensington Palace spokesperson told the outlet. “But we have been really clear that she needs the space and the privacy to recover right now. She will return to work when she has had the green light from doctors.”
